Leading family location-based service Life360 said it has revived Nasdaq plans for a U.S. initial public offering (IPO) to raise up to US$100 million (A$151 million), but has yet to determine the number of shares and price range for the listing.
The location-sharing app announced the S-3 filing after securing investor support recently, after it said would enable ads on its platform to generate additional revenue.
